Our website may use cookies and similar technologies to support website functionality, improve user experience, monitor website performance and understand how visitors use the site.
Cookies are small text files that may be stored on your device when you visit a website.
We use Google Analytics to collect information about how visitors use our website, such as pages visited, traffic sources, device/browser information and general website usage patterns. This information helps us understand and improve website performance.
We may also use Google Ads conversion tracking to help us measure the effectiveness of our advertising campaigns, for example when a visitor submits an enquiry form, clicks to call, requests a callback, or completes another relevant action on our website.
Analytics and advertising/conversion tracking cookies are non-essential cookies. Where required, we will ask for your consent before placing these cookies on your device.
You can manage or withdraw your cookie consent through the cookie settings available on our website. You can also manage or disable cookies through your browser settings. Please note that some parts of the website may not function correctly if cookies are disabled.
